📋 Product Overview
The Certikin Swimflo HPS031M is a purpose-built 0.3HP (0.24kW) single-phase pump designed specifically for domestic swimming pool filtration. This self-priming pump combines robust construction with efficient operation, making it an ideal choice for homeowners seeking reliable, low-maintenance pool circulation without the complexity or cost of larger commercial systems.
Constructed from durable thermoplastic materials of the latest generation, the HPS031M incorporates an integrated pre-filter to protect hydraulic components from debris and foreign objects. With 1.5″ suction and delivery connections, this pump delivers consistent performance while maintaining energy efficiency that helps keep running costs manageable. The IP-55 rated motor is specifically designed to withstand the hot, humid environments typical of pool installations, ensuring long-term reliability even in challenging conditions.

🔧 Technical Specifications
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Model | Certikin Swimflo HPS031M |
| Power Rating | 0.3HP (0.24kW) |
| Phase | Single phase |
| Voltage | 230V |
| Frequency | 50Hz |
| Maximum Head | 11 metres |
| Connection Size | 1.5″ (50mm) suction & delivery |
| Connection Type | Quick connect unions (included) |
| Motor Protection | IP-55, Class F |
| Motor Rating | Continuous duty |
| Impeller Material | Noryl |
| Shaft Material | Stainless steel |
| Body Material | Thermoplastic composite |
| Pre-Filter | Integrated strainer basket |
| Salt Compatible | Yes |
| Weight | 9.5kg |
| Overall Length (A) | 495mm |
| Overall Width (B) | 265mm |
| Overall Height (C) | 240mm |
| Motor Housing Height (E) | 230mm |
| Base Width (F) | 145mm |
| Motor Length (G) | 250mm |
| Pump Body Length (H) | 210mm |
| Strainer Height (I) | 130mm |
| Port Diameter (D) | 50mm (1.5″) |
| Warranty | 2 years manufacturer warranty |
Flow Rate Performance
| Head (metres) | Flow Rate (m³/hr) |
|---|---|
| 4m | 12.5 |
| 6m | 9.5 |
| 8m | 6.3 |
| 10m | 3.0 |
| 11m (max) | – |
💰 Usage Costs & Running Expenses
📊 Annual Running Cost Calculation
Understanding the running costs of your pool pump helps you budget accurately and make informed decisions about operation schedules.
Power Consumption:
- Rated power: 0.24kW (0.3HP)
- Current UK domestic electricity rate: £0.26 per kWh (October-December 2025 price cap)
Typical Swimming Pool Usage Scenario:
- Operating schedule: 6 hours per day during swimming season
- Swimming season: 150 days per year (approximately May through September)
- Annual operating hours: 6 × 150 = 900 hours
✅ Annual Running Cost:
- Energy consumption: 0.24kW × 900 hours = 216 kWh
- Annual cost: 216 × £0.26 = £56.16
Year-Round Heated Pool Scenario:
- Operating schedule: 4 hours per day year-round
- Annual operating hours: 4 × 365 = 1,460 hours
- Energy consumption: 0.24kW × 1,460 hours = 350.4 kWh
- Annual cost: 350.4 × £0.26 = £91.10

🎯 Real World Examples & Applications
🏊 Small to Medium Residential Pools
The HPS031M is ideally suited for domestic pools up to 30,000-40,000 litres. With sufficient flow capacity to turn over pool water in 6-8 hours, it provides effective filtration while maintaining energy efficiency. Perfect for family gardens where swimming is seasonal and operating costs need to remain manageable.
🛁 Hot Tubs & Spa Circulation
For hot tub owners requiring a dedicated circulation pump separate from jet pumps, the HPS031M delivers reliable low-flow circulation for filtration and heating. Its compact dimensions (495mm × 265mm × 240mm) make installation straightforward even in confined plant rooms or decking enclosures.
🌊 Water Features & Small Ponds
Ideal for decorative water features, koi ponds, and ornamental fountains requiring continuous circulation. The self-priming capability makes it particularly suitable for installations where the pump is positioned above water level, such as poolside equipment housings or elevated plant rooms.
